Certificates accredited by ESYD

Terms of Use of the PASS-PORT Certificate

  1. This PASS-PORT Certificate of Knowledge of Computer Science or Computer Handling (Basic Level) and valid photocopies thereof, may be used as official evidence of knowledge certification only for the subjects listed therein.
  2. This Certificate may be presented as proof of certification only for the subjects listed therein and only upon request.
  3. The holder of the Certificate may declare its possession and display it only for the subjects listed therein.
  4. The holder of the Certificate must not use it in a misleading or irregular manner.
  5. The holder of the Certificate must not declare anything related to the specific certification that may be considered misleading.
  6. The Certificate Holder must immediately inform PASS of any matters that may affect its ability to continue to meet the requirements of the certification.
  7. The Certificate Holder must immediately cease all use and reference to it, if it has been revoked or withdrawn for any reason.
  8. The Certificate Holder must immediately return to PASS any certification documents related to the revoked or withdrawn certificate, including the certificate itself.
  9. The validity period of this Certificate is five years, in accordance with its ELOT EN ISO/IEC 17024 accredited status.

Terms of Use of the PASS-PARTOUT

  1. This Certificate of Specialized Professional Knowledge – PASS-PARTOUT
    and valid photocopies thereof, may be used as official evidence of knowledge certification only for the subjects listed therein.
  2. This Certificate does not constitute a license for the legal practice of the certified profession and its holder is not granted professional rights herewith, unless this is provided for by relevant legislative, regulatory or administrative provisions.
  3. This Certificate may be presented as proof of knowledge only for the subjects listed therein and only upon request.
  4. The holder of the Certificate may declare its possession and display it only for the subjects listed therein.
  5. The holder of the Certificate must not use it in a misleading or irregular manner.
  6. The holder of the Certificate must not declare anything related to the specific certification that may be considered misleading.
  7. The Certificate Holder must immediately inform PASS of any matters that may affect its ability to continue to meet the requirements of the certification.
  8. The Certificate Holder must immediately cease all use and reference to it, if it has been revoked or withdrawn for any reason.
  9. The Certificate Holder must immediately return to PASS any certification documents related to the revoked or withdrawn certificate, including the certificate itself.
  10. The validity period of this Certificate is five years, in accordance with its ELOT EN ISO/IEC 17024 accredited status.

Certificates recognized by EOPPEP

Terms of Use of the PASS-PORT Certificate

  1. This Certificate of Knowledge of Computer Science or Computer Operation (Basic Level) PASS-PORT and valid photocopies thereof may be used as official evidence of knowledge certification only for the subjects listed therein.
  2. This Certificate may be displayed as evidence of knowledge certification only for the subjects listed therein and only upon relevant request.
  3. The holder of the Certificate may declare its possession and display it only for the subjects listed therein.
  4. The holder of the Certificate must not use it in a misleading or irregular manner.
  5. The Certificate holder must not state anything related to the specific certification that may be considered misleading.
  6. The Certificate holder must immediately cease all use and reference to it, if it has been revoked or withdrawn for any reason.
  7. The Certificate holder must immediately return to PASS any certification documents related to the certificate under revocation or withdrawal, including the certificate itself.
  8. This certificate is accepted for recruitment to the Greek State through the procedures established by the State and, in accordance with Law L. 4283/2014 (Government Gazette 189/A’/10-09-2014), its validity is indefinite.
